High-Performance 256×192 VOx Thermal Imaging Camera Module – LWIR Night Vision for Security Perimeter
This high-performance thermal imaging camera module features a 256×192 vanadium oxide (VOx) uncooled microbolometer sensor. Operating in the Long-Wave Infrared (LWIR) 8-14μm spectrum, it captures thermal radiation and converts it into clear images and accurate temperature data. The module is compact, energy-efficient, and ideal for integration into security systems, industrial equipment, handheld devices, and smart home appliances. Temperature Measurement – Industrial & Human
This thermal module is designed for two main use cases:
Industrial Temperature Measurement
- Range: -15°C to +150°C (high gain mode) or +50°C to +550°C (low gain mode)
- Accuracy: ±2°C or ±2%
- Ideal for equipment inspection, electrical panels, and manufacturing quality control
Human / Biological Temperature Measurement
- Range: +30°C to +45°C
- Accuracy: ±0.5°C
- Suitable for fever screening at building entrances, airports, and offices

Technical Specifications at a Glance
Sensor
- Type: Uncooled VOx microbolometer
- Spectral band: 8μm to 14μm (LWIR)
- Resolution: 256×192 or 160×120
- Pixel pitch: 12μm
- NETD: Less than 50mK at 25°C with F#1.0 lens at 25Hz
- Response time: Under 10ms
- Frame rate: Up to 25Hz
- Non-uniformity correction: Automatic with shutter
- Image output: 10-bit or 14-bit CMOS
Lens
- Type: Athermalized (stable focus across temperature changes)
Electrical Interface
- Input voltage: 3.3V or 5V
- Image data output: SPI or DVP
- Command and control: I2C
- Power consumption: 240mW typical during operation, 600mW during shutter event
Physical Dimensions
- Size: 13mm x 13mm x 8mm
- Weight: 3.7g (2.0mm lens), 3.9g (3.2mm lens), 4.1g (4.3mm lens)
Environmental Tolerance
- Operating (imaging): -40°C to 80°C
- Operating (industrial measurement): -10°C to 75°C
- Operating (biological measurement): 10°C to 50°C
- Storage: -45°C to 85°C
- Shock: 25g at 11ms, half sine wave, XYZ directions
